Lil' Harvard First Step Private Learning Center

514 1/2 Texas Parkway
Missouri City, TX 77489
"The educational philosophy of Lil' Harvard is to provide activities that will challenge the growth of the child.
We focus on the child's basic nutritional health and safety needs, with a curriculum that emphasizes the whole child including his or her social , emotional, intellectual, and physical needs. ".
